É possÃvel usar Expressões Regulares nos atributos Dado, Quando Então de suas definições de etapa. Isso dá ao desenvolvedor / testador a capacidade de reutilizar Definições de Etapa.
[Given(@"I have an object with the name '(.+)'")]
public void ExampleStepDefinition(string objectName)
{
...
}
Mas lembre-se de colocar a regex entre colchetes, pois Specflow lança um erro de incompatibilidade de parâmetro.